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
23974 87144836 742 697
1427 4855 953022921
1427 4855 953022921
23 05205085 9502221
All about undefined
Interested in learning more?
1427 4855 953022921
23 05205085 9502221
See more
94 054 974489304
4683 91921017660 845 633
See more
0274789002 09168 453
478912044 9261762348 12
See more